Those are usefull for compatibility with the kernel. Remove the locally defined pr_debug() in atmel_mci.c.
Signed-off-by: Alexander Holler holler@ahsoftware.de
drivers/mmc/atmel_mci.c | 6 ------ include/common.h | 4 ++++ 2 files changed, 4 insertions(+), 6 deletions(-)
NAK. This is just adding redundant overhead. I don;t want to have yet another incarnation of macros which already exist.
Either replace the code in drivers/mmc/atmel_mci.c by a simple
#define pr_debug(fmt, args...) debug(fmt, ##args)
or convert the code that uses this reference.
And pr_info() is completrely redundant and not used anywhere.
If you really think that pr_debug() is so much better than debug(), then convert ALL code to use that. But I am not a friend of such a change.
